[1] As a cultural institution and exhibition centre, the House of European History intends to promote the understanding of European history and European integration, through a permanent exhibition and temporary and travelling exhibitions. The museum is an initiative by the European Parliament, and was proposed by then-president Hans-Gert Pöttering in 2007; it opened on 6 May 2017. In December 2012, in the context of the Nobel Peace Prize awarded to the European Union,[8] it was decided that the Nobel medal and diploma will form part of the permanent exhibition of the House of European History, as the first objects in its collection.[9][10]. Using 1500 objects and documents from over 300 museums and collections from across Europe and beyond, and an extensive range of media, it provides a journey through the history of Europe, principally that of the 20th century, with retrospectives on developments and events in earlier periods which were of particular significance for the whole continent.
